OK04 XKR is a 2004 Jaguar Xkr in Blue with a 4,196c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87%.
Across all 2004 Jaguar Xkr models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.8% with a typical mileage of 59,164 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jaguar Xkr f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,083 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OK04 XKR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jaguar Xkr typ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 22 years old, this Jaguar Xkr is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
